Several external plugin authors have reported that uploads to the SproutCycle scheduler marketplace fail with SIGNATURE_MISMATCH since the 3.2 rollout. Investigation shows our verifier now requires manifests signed against the updated trust root, while older tooling still references the retired chain. Please re-sign your plugin bundles before resubmitting; unsigned or legacy-signed packages will be rejected automatically. For convenience during the transition, the current marketplace signing key is included below.

signing key of fajof-tagag = bky3_rJk

Release checklist — Harborline gateway, item 7: health checks behind the load balancer. Verify that the shallow /alive endpoint and the deep /ready endpoint are both registered, and that the balancer drains connections for 30 seconds before removing a node. Confirm the readiness probe checks the Copperfen database pool, not just process liveness, since last quarter's incident stemmed from nodes reporting healthy while starved of connections. Document the probe intervals in the sync notes. The validated build for this item is recorded below.

trace token, fafog-kageg: htk4_98e6

## Deployment

FuelGauge generates the weekly fleet fuel-usage report from telematics exports. Deploy by pushing a tagged release; the pipeline builds, runs the smoke suite, and rolls out to the reporting cluster. Rollbacks are one command away and safe, since reports are idempotent. The deployed service reads the following configuration values.

config for kafof-bawef:
holath:
  log_level: debug
  metrics_host: metrics.holath.qorvelsys.internal
  pin: 2191
  pool_size: 32